What is the role of culture in magic?
Magic is an ancient practice that has been part of human culture and spirituality for thousands of years. The role of culture in magic is significant, as it shapes the beliefs, practices, and traditions associated with magic in different parts of the world.
There are many different types of magic that are influenced by culture, such as African magic, Asian magic, European magic, and Native American magic, to name a few. Each culture has its own unique beliefs, practices, and rituals that are associated with magic. For example, African magic is known for its connection to ancestral spirits, while Native American magic often involves connecting with nature spirits.
Culture also influences the way magic is learned and passed down through generations. Many cultures have specific traditions and ceremonies associated with magic, which are often passed down through oral traditions or written texts. These traditions help preserve the knowledge and practices of magic and ensure that they are passed down to future generations.
In addition to shaping the practices and traditions of magic, culture also plays a role in how magic is perceived and understood. In some cultures, magic is seen as an integral part of everyday life and spirituality, while in others it may be viewed with skepticism or even fear.
Ultimately, the role of culture in magic is complex and multifaceted. It shapes the practices, traditions, and beliefs associated with magic, and also influences the way magic is learned, passed down, and understood. By understanding the role of culture in magic, we can gain a deeper appreciation for the rich and diverse history of this ancient practice.
